Tubman to Replace Jackson on $20 Bill
Treasury Secretary Jack Lew is expected to announce later Wednesday that Harriet Tubman will replace former President Andrew Jackson on the $20 bill.
The move makes Tubman the first woman on U.S. paper currency in 100 years.
Lew is also expected to announce changes to the $10 bill. Alexander Hamilton will stay on the bill, however, there will be a montage of leaders from the women’s suffrage movement added on the back.
The new bill is expected to enter circulation by 2020.
